The amount of preliminary tax for a year must be equal to, or more than, the lowest amount of the following:
- 90% of the tax due for that tax year
- 100% of the tax due for the immediately previous tax year
- 105% of the tax due for the tax year preceding the immediately previous tax year (often called the ‘pre-preceding year’). This option only applies where you pay by direct debit. It does not apply if the tax due for the pre-preceding year was nil.
Tax chargeable for the period is €30,000
Paid under PAYE and DWT €25,000
Tax payable €5,000
Do I have to pay 90% of the €5,000 i.e. €4,500 - I presume it's this one.
Or 90% of the €30,000 which is €27,000 less €25,000 already paid, so €2,000
